Looking back, a few enduring phrases of female empowerment remain ingrained in our culture today. Oprah Winfrey, for example, has been credited with helping bring the phrase, “You go, girl!” into popular culture as a term of endearment for women stepping up to a challenge.
Multiple studies have demonstrated the value of diverse thinking, which has continued to evolve the modern workplace and open doors for women. Today, I’m finding that an increasing number of management teams recognize the importance and urgency of further progress for women in leadership. The results are tangible. Earlier this year, Fortune reported that women now hold 10.4% of Fortune 500 CEO positions. While there is still work to be done, I believe the numbers are an encouraging step forward.
